What "certification" suggests in practice

Certification in mental health covers 3 tiers in Australia.

image

At the fundamental end, short courses construct proficiency and preparedness. These include emergency treatment for mental health courses, crisis mental health training for workplaces, and the 11379NAT Course in Initial Response to a Mental Health Crisis. Numerous are made to assist non‑clinicians determine red flags, give secure initial support, and refer forward. Employers typically make these a standard for people-leaders or a marked psychological wellness support officer.

In the middle are employment certifications straightened to the Australian Qualifications Structure. These are generally delivered by Registered Training Organisations under ASQA oversight. Examples consist of Certificate IV and Diploma-level programs in mental wellness or alcohol and other drugs. They prepare you for frontline functions in community services, psychosocial support, and peer work. Graduates learn to intend support, handle danger, file appropriately, and work together with clinicians.

At the advanced end, controlled careers require tertiary credentials and registration. Psycho therapists sign up with AHPRA. Psychiatrists full medical levels and expert training. Psychological wellness registered nurses, social workers, and physical therapists comply with certified degree pathways. If your goal is to identify, provide therapy, or prescribe medication, you will need a level plus registration or recommendation, not just a short course.

image

Understanding which tier fits your function keeps you from over‑training for a role you don't require, or under‑preparing for obligations you intend to take on.

Nationally certified courses and ASQA oversight

ASQA recognizes training courses when they meet nationwide criteria for expertise outcomes, evaluation quality, and industry relevance. When you see language like nationally accredited training, ASQA accredited courses, or nationally accredited courses, it signals uniformity and mobility. A device finished in Brisbane ought to lug the very same weight in Ballarat.

The 11379NAT collection beings in this classification. NAT-coded credentials are across the country recognized but owned by a particular program proprietor, not a nationwide training package. The owner keeps the educational program, analysis problems, and top quality review cycle, while ASQA guarantees criteria are promoted across accepted service providers. For you as a student, that suggests the web content has actually been vetted and the outcomes are plainly defined.

Non recognized training courses can still be beneficial, particularly for internal capability building or understanding projects. The trade‑off is acknowledgment. Non‑accredited certificates generally do not verbalize into refresher course, nor do they show expertise to external companies in the very same way.

The role of 11379NAT: a preliminary situation response ability set

The 11379NAT Course in Initial Response to a Mental Health Crisis is designed for people who are not medical professionals yet may be the very first to observe a circumstance weakening. Think of a team leader who identifies a personnel in intense distress, a fitness center supervisor whose customer all of a sudden shows signs of panic and dissociation, or an university advisor taking care of a trainee that is at risk.

Core results concentrate on understanding what a mental health crisis is, using first aid in mental health securely, and working with next actions. The focus is practical, scenario‑based, and based in danger mitigation.

A normal shipment mixes pre‑learning with live method. One of the most valuable sessions I've observed placed learners through reasonable simulations. The trainer pauses the activity, asks why a concern was phrased a particular method, and checks out alternatives. That depth matters greater than the variety of slides. The most effective companies analyze not only knowledge yet a learner's capacity to remain calm, set boundaries, and escalate correctly.

If you are looking into mental health courses in Australia and require a credential that speaks straight to crisis mental health feedback without entering clinical region, the 11379NAT mental health course makes its reputation. It squarely addresses first aid for mental health crisis situations, and it is commonly identified by companies building a network of psychological wellness assistance officers.

What counts as a mental wellness crisis

The term covers a variety of urgent situations where safety, feature, or judgment suffers and instant support is called for. Instances include active suicidal ideation with a strategy, serious self-harm threat, psychosis with escalating frustration, anxiety attack that endanger breathing and positioning, and extreme depressive episodes where the person is incapable to perform standard jobs and shows quick decline.

Recognition is the very first guard. I as soon as collaborated with a friendliness team where a client presented with slurred speech and frustration. Staff assumed intoxication. An employee learnt emergency treatment for mental health noticed missed out on hints: disorganised speech content, intense worry about hidden threats, and a flat rejection to consume water because it could be infected. The action altered from rejection of solution to relax control, safety preparation, and calling a mobile situation group. Training made that difference.

Where refresher training fits

Skills deteriorate without technique. Organisations that integrate mental health crisis training right into daily procedures normally schedule a mental health refresher every 12 to 24 months. The 11379NAT mental health refresher course, in some cases styled as mental health correspondence course 11379NAT, provides qualified team a possibility to review threat analysis, borders, and recommendation pathways. Great refreshers upgrade legal commitments, cross‑check neighborhood situation lines, and sharpen function clarity.

Rote refresher programs are a wild-goose chase. Try to find service providers that run upgraded scenarios, generate lived experience voices, and examination de‑escalation under stress. I expect to see new information on case fads in the field, modifications to family members and domestic violence danger testing, and updated area resources. If your workforce includes night shift or remote websites, insist on method situations that show those constraints.

Accreditation, regulation, and top quality checks

ASQA accredited programs have to be supplied by an RTO approved for the certification. That approval covers fitness instructor proficiencies, evaluation validation, and pupil support. Ask carriers for their RTO code, verification of range, and a program outline including units of expertise. For NAT‑coded courses like 11379NAT, examine the most recent version, as program codes and systems can be upgraded over time.

Quality is visible in assessment layout. Look for assessments that require demonstration, not just quizzes. Situation job relies on communication tone, limit setting, and situational understanding, which are much better examined with monitoring and role‑play. Feedback should specify, behavior‑based, and tied to the device's performance criteria.

When professional mental health services Adelaide comparing suppliers of accredited mental health courses, consider instructor backgrounds. The very best facilitators are experts who have dealt with actual de‑escalations and understand the messiness of live occurrences. They can explain why a soft, open concern worked in one situation but enhanced rumination in one more, or when to pivot from security planning to immediate emergency situation response.

Inside the 11379NAT finding out experience

Expect the content to unload crisis categories, cautioning signs, and social considerations. You will find out how to open a discussion, scale prompt risk, and choose whether to call three-way zero, a local dilemma group, or a family contact. Excellent fitness instructors will push you to be particular instead of vague. "I'm worried regarding your safety and security today" is more useful than "I'm concerned," since it welcomes a focused risk check as opposed to a basic reassurance.

You will additionally practice border statements. Among the most typical errors among well‑meaning -responders is handling commitments they can not fulfill. Training helps you claim, and suggest, "I can stick with you while we get in touch with assistance, but I can not assure I will be available later tonight." Limits are ethical, not chilly. They secure the individual in dilemma from uncertain follow‑through and secure you from burnout.

Documentation obtains focus also. In a workplace, you will certainly need to tape-record what happened, what was concurred, and what actions you took. That record needs to be factual and minimal, shared only with those that need to recognize. Training covers personal privacy amongst colleagues, just how to stay clear of analysis tags, and just how to record danger without revealing more than is necessary.

First aid for psychological health versus therapy

A constant misconception is that first aid mental health training gives you tools to "take care of" somebody. It does not. It shows you to stabilise the instant scenario, listen without escalating, decrease threat, and link the individual to lasting supports. The example to physical emergency treatment is apt: you can use a stress plaster and screen breathing, yet you would certainly not attempt surgery.

There is a gray zone, however, where individuals value a little bit of psychoeducation. If a person is hyperventilating throughout a panic attack, a tranquil explanation regarding the body's stress and anxiety response can aid. The line is crossed when suggestions becomes authoritative or when you attempt to treat injury or mood problems. Training stresses that line and provides you manuscripts to remain within it.

Cost, period, and delivery

Pricing varies by service provider and format. As a reference point, expect a one or two‑day 11379NAT shipment, often with pre‑learning. Costs for individuals frequently sit in the low hundreds to just over a thousand bucks, relying on whether it is corporate on‑site or public enrolment. Team reservations bring the per‑head expense down. Some service providers provide combined distribution, with theory online and practical analysis personally. For dilemma skills, I favour in‑person analysis because the subtleties of tone and existence are harder to examine online, though crossbreed models can work with careful facilitation.

Funding alternatives exist in some states for top priority friends. If your role lines up with neighborhood security or wellness promo, ask companies regarding subsidies or partnerships.

Evidence that the training sticks

The greatest indication isn't the certification; it is behaviour adjustment under stress. After certification, you need to see faster recognition of warnings, smoother escalations, less worried contact us to managers, and much better documents. In a retail network I supported, occurrence duration for non‑emergency crises stopped by roughly 30 percent within 6 months of rolling out first aid mental health training, mainly because team made previously, more clear decisions. Calls to emergency situation services did not spike, however unnecessary "covering our bases" calls declined, as danger analyses ended up being more confident.

Track data lightly however regularly: number of incidents, time to resolution, referrals made, and follow‑up results. Shield personal privacy and avoid recording clinical detail. Over a year, you will certainly see whether your training mix is satisfying the risk account of your setting.
